Sat 1179150826864246

decimal
261660.826864246
degree
0°51660′1596″826864246‴
percentile
56.150039436252975%
name
fmopfwpcxrn
cycle
0
epoch
1
period
129
block
261660
offset
826864246
timestamp
rarity
common